eb4e52b3f3 rtw89: fix incorrect channel info during scan
We used to fill in rx skbs' frequency field by mac80211's current
channel value. In some cases, mac80211 switches channel before all
rx packets have been processed. This results in incorrect bss info.
We fix this by filling in frequency field with channel index obtained
from hardware, then fix potential cck missing issue by skb's original
hw rate. After all fix is done, convert hw rate back to the supported
band rate index.

30101812a0 rtw89: fix potentially access out of range of RF register array
The RF register array is used to help firmware to restore RF settings.
The original code can potentially access out of range, if the size is
between (RTW89_H2C_RF_PAGE_SIZE * RTW89_H2C_RF_PAGE_NUM + 1) to
((RTW89_H2C_RF_PAGE_SIZE + 1) * RTW89_H2C_RF_PAGE_NUM). Fortunately,
current used size doesn't fall into the wrong case, and the size will not
change if we don't update RF parameter.

5425771497 rtw89: update rtw89 regulation definition to R58-R31
Support QATAR in rtw89_regulation_type and reorder the enum to align
realtek R58-R31 regulation definition. Besides, if an unassigned entry
of limit/limit_ru tables is read, return the corresponding WW value for
the unconfigured case.

e3ec7017f6 rtw89: add Realtek 802.11ax driver
This driver named rtw89, which is the next generation of rtw88, supports
Realtek 8852AE 802.11ax 2x2 chip whose new features are OFDMA, DBCC,
Spatial reuse, TWT and BSS coloring; now some of them aren't implemented
though.

The chip architecture is entirely different from the chips supported by
rtw88 like RTL8822CE 802.11ac chip. First of all, register address ranges
are totally redefined, so it's impossible to reuse register definition. To
communicate with firmware, new H2C/C2H format is proposed. In order to have
better utilization, TX DMA flow is changed to two stages DMA. To provide
rich RX status information, additional RX PPDU packets are added.

Since there are so many differences mentioned above, we decide to propose
a new driver. It has many authors, they are listed in alphabetic order:
